二 Java开发环境搭建

JDK下载与安装

JDK卸载

  1. 删除java的安装目录
  2. 删除JAVA_HOME
  3. 删除path下关于java的目录
  4. java -version查看是否删除

安装JDK

  1. 百度搜索JDK8,找到下载地址
  2. 同意协议
  3. 下载电脑对应的版本
  4. 双击安装JDK
  5. 记住安装的路径
  6. 配置环境变量
    1. 我的电脑 ​–> 右键 -->属性
    2. 环境变量 --> JAVA_HOME
    3. 配置path变量
  7. 测试JDK是否安装成功
    1. 打开cmd
    2. java -version

JDK目录介绍

  • bin目录 : 可执行文件(编译器、解释器)
  • include目录 : 引入C/C++的头文件 (jdk用C/C++编写的)
  • jre目录 :java运行时环境
  • lib目录 : JDK工具命令的实际执行程序
  • src文件 : 资源文件 (java所有核心类库的源代码)

HelloWorld

  1. 随便新建一个文件夹,存放代码

  2. 新建一个java文件

    • 文件后缀名 .java
    • Hello.java
    • 【注意点】:系统可能没有显示文件后缀名,我们需要手动打开
  3. 编写代码

//注意类名要和文件名相同
//大小写  英文符号 
public class Hello{
	public static void main(String[] args){
		System.out.print("Hello,world");
	}
}
  1. 编译文件,输入以下命令, 会产生一个class文件
javac Hello.java
  1. 运行class文件,输入命令 会得到运行结果
java Hello

image-20211204195850038

注意:要在当前文件目录下,打开cmd窗口

Java程序运行机制

  • 编译型:使用专门的编译器,将高级语言源代码一次性的编译成可被该平台硬件执行的机器码,并包装成该平台所能识别的可执行性程序的格式。
    • 优势:运行速度快,代码效率高,编译后的程序不可修改,保密性较好。
    • 缺点:代码需要经过编译方可运行,可移植性差,只能在兼容的操作系统上运行 。
    • 应用:操作系统、C、C++
  • 解释型:使用专门的解释器对源程序逐行解释成特定平台的机器码并立即执行。是代码在执行时才被解释器一行行动态翻译和执行,而不是在执行之前就完成翻译。
    • 优点:可移植性较好,只要有解释环境,可在不同的操作系统上运行。
    • 缺点:运行需要解释环境,运行起来比编译的要慢,占用资源也要多一些,代码效率低,代码修改后就可运行,不需要编译过程。
    • 应用场景 : 网页等速度要求不高 java、javascript、python
  • 程序运行机制
    • JAVA语言是一种编译型-解释型语言,同时具备编译特性和解释特性(其实,确切的说java就是解释型语言,其所谓的编译过程只是将.java文件预编译成平台无关的字节码.class文件,并不是向C一样编译成可执行的机器语言)。
    • 作为编译型语言,JAVA程序要被统一编译成字节码文件——文件后缀是class。此种文件在java中又称为类文件。java类文件不能再计算机上直接执行,它需要被java虚拟机翻译成本地的机器码后才能执行,而java虚拟机的翻译过程则是解释性的。java字节码文件首先被加载到计算机内存中,然后读出一条指令,翻译一条指令,执行一条指令,该过程被称为java语言的解释执行,是由java虚拟机完成的。

preview

IDEA安装

IDE

  • 定义:集成开发环境(IDE,Integrated Development Environment )是用于提供程序开发环境的应用程序,一般包括代码编辑器、编译器、调试器和图形用户界面等工具。集成了代码编写功能、分析功能、编译功能、调试功能等一体化的开发软件服务套。所有具备这一特性的软件或者软件套(组)都可以叫集成开发环境。

  • 举例:Visual Studio系列,Eclipse,IDEA

IDEA下载安装(图解)

1)进入 IDEA 官方下载页面,(官网地址为 https://www.jetbrains.com/idea/),点击 DOWNLOAD,如图 1 所示。

IntelliJ IDEA官方下载页面2)IntelliJ IDEA 是一款跨平台的开发工具,支持 Windows、Mac、Linux 等操作系统,我们可以根据需求下载对应的版本。旗舰版的功能更加全面,这里我们选择下载旗舰版。然后点击 Download,如图 2 所示。

IntelliJ IDEA 提供了两个版本,即 Ultimate(旗舰版) 和 Community(社区版)。社区版是免费的,但它的功能较少。旗舰版是商业版,提供了一组出色的工具和特性。关于两个版本差异的详细信息,可以参考下图。

😏旗舰版的破解方式可以网上搜索教程

选择操作系统页面
图 2 选择操作系统页面

最终版和社区版的差异
3)点击下载后可能需要注册,一般情况下,不用理会,浏览器会自动进行下载,等待下载完成即可。

4)下载完成后,我们会得到一个 IntelliJ IDEA 安装包,双击打开下载的安装包,选择 Next,正式开始安装。

IDEA开始安装界面
5)设置 IDEA 的安装目录,建议不要安装在系统盘(通常 C 盘是系统盘),这里选择安装到 D 盘。

设置IDEA安装目录
6)自行选择需要的功能,若无特殊需求,按图中勾选即可。

IDEA安装设置对话框

对上图中选项说明如下:

  • Create Desktop Shortcut:创建桌面快捷方式图标,建议勾选 64-bit launcher;
  • Update context menu:是否将从文件夹打开项目添加至鼠标右键,根据需要勾选;
  • Create Associations:关联文件格式,可以不推荐勾选,使用如 Sublime Text、EditPlus 等轻量级文本编辑器打开;
  • Download and install 32-bit JetBrains Runtime:下载并安装 JetBrains 的 JRE。如果已经安装了JRE,则无需勾选此项;
  • Update PATH variable (restart needed):是否将 IDEA 启动目录添加到环境变量中,即可以从命令行中启动 IDEA,根据需要勾选。
    7)选择开始菜单文件夹后,点击 Install 等待安装。

选择开始菜单文件夹
图 7 选择开始菜单文件夹
8)等待安装进度条达到 100% 后,点击 Finish,IntelliJ IDEA 就安装完成了。可以勾选 Run IntelliJ IDEA 选项,表示关闭此窗口后运行 IDEA。

安装完成页面

IDEA创建第一个Java程序(图解)

1、打开 IDEA,创建一个新的项目。

img

2、在弹出的对话框中,选择 Java,第一次使用的时候,要选择我们之前下载好的 JDK 文件。

img

3、点击下一步,这里我们不使用推荐的,我们自己来手动建立。

img

4、点击下一步,填写我们的项目名称和选择项目的路径地址。

img

5、点击 Finish,项目会自动创建和进行加载,并进入主页面,主页面左边是我们的项目目录结构。

img

6、我们在 src 目录下边创建一个 package。

img

img

7、在上一步创建的 package 上面在创建一个 HelloWorld 类。

img

img

8、创建完 HelloWorld 类,可以看到下面的效果。

img

9、在我们的主函数中写一个输出语句。

img

10、右击点击运行。

img

11、执行结果。

img

引用:

http://c.biancheng.net/view/7592.html
https://www.cnblogs.com/hanwen1014/p/9053492.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值